테스트 사이트 - 개발 중인 베타 버전입니다

그누보드 사설 아이피만 접속 허용할려면 어떻게 해야하나요? 채택완료

아데산야 4년 전 조회 4,092
  • Class A : 10.0.0.0 ~ 10.255.255.255
  • Class B : 172.16.0.0 ~ 172.31.255.255
  • Class C : 192.168.0.0 ~ 192.168.255.255

 

위에 처럼 사설 아이피에 해당 될 경우 접속을 허용을 하고 아니면 접속을 못하게 하고 싶습니다. 

 

어떻게 하면 될까요?

 

공유기 내부로만 접속을 허용 하고 외부는 지정된 아이피만 하나만 허용할려고 합니다. 

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

채택된 답변
+20 포인트
4년 전

/extend/user.config.php

</p>

<p>$ipdb = array("10\.", "172\.16\.", "192\.168\.");

$ip = $_SERVER['REMOTE_ADDR'];</p>

<p>for ($i = 0; $i < count($ipdb); $i++) {

  if (!preg_match("/^".$ipdb[$i]."/", $ip) ) {

        die("허용되지 않은 아이피 입니다.");

  }

}</p>

<p>

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

아데산야
4년 전
감사합니다 ㅠ

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인